Giani Hira Singh Award to
Punjabi Sahit Sabha California
Award ceremony to be held on 6 July
WSN Bureau
SACREMENTO:
Amidst a galaxy of Punjabi litterateurs from all over the world, the
Punjabi Sath Giani Hira Singh award would be conferred on the
Punjabi Sahit Sabha
California
for its services towards propagation of the Punjabi language at Yuba
City on 6th July.
According to the
press statement of the Sabha released by its president, Harbans
Singh Jagiasu, among others Dr. Swaraj Singh Seattle, Prof.
Gurbhajan Singh Gill from Punjab Agricultural University Ludhiana,
Dr. Suhinderbir Singh from Guru Nanak Dev University, Prof. Harpal
Singh from Sikh National College Banga, famous poet Eng. Karamjit
Singh, Tarlochan Singh Dopalpur and others who have served the cause
of Punjabi would attend the ceremony.
All participants
would deliberate upon the status of Punjabi language and suggest
measures to improve the reach of the language. The organisers have
